Founded in 1941, the Detroit Pistons have long been synonymous with tough, physical basketball. Based in the Motor City, this team has always embodied the blue-collar work ethic of its hometown. Over the years, the Pistons have produced some of the greatest players in NBA history, including Isiah Thomas, Joe Dumars, and Dennis Rodman. Their “Bad Boys” era in the late 1980s remains one of the most iconic periods in NBA history, where they dominated with their relentless defense and aggressive playstyle.
Fast forward to the 2000s, and the Pistons were still a force to be reckoned with. Led by legends like Rasheed Wallace, Ben Wallace, Tayshaun Prince, and Chauncey Billups, they won the NBA Championship in 2004, defeating the heavily favored Los Angeles Lakers. This victory cemented their status as a team that thrives under pressure and delivers when it matters most.
On the other side of the court, we have the Miami Heat, a team that has become a symbol of perseverance and adaptability. Established in 1988, the Heat quickly established themselves as a formidable force in the NBA. Their rise to prominence was spearheaded by none other than Pat Riley, one of the most successful coaches in basketball history.
The Heat’s golden era came in the early 2010s when they welcomed LeBron James, Dwyane Wade, and Chris Bosh to their roster. This trio, known as the “Big Three,” led the Heat to four consecutive NBA Finals appearances, winning back-to-back championships in 2012 and 2013. Even after LeBron’s departure, the Heat have continued to compete at the highest level, showcasing their ability to rebuild and remain competitive.

One of the most memorable series between the Pistons and Heat came in the 2000s, when both teams faced off in the Eastern Conference playoffs. The Heat, led by Shaquille O’Neal and Dwyane Wade, went up against a Pistons team that included Chauncey Billups and Rasheed Wallace. The series was a back-and-forth affair, with both teams showcasing their strengths and weaknesses.
In the end, the Heat emerged victorious, but not without a fight. These playoff battles have only fueled the rivalry, making every subsequent matchup more intense.
